Side-by-side traits
| Trait | Australian Terrier | Miniature Schnauzer |
|---|---|---|
Group | Terrier | Terrier |
Size | Small | Small |
Origin | Australia | Germany |
Height (male) | 10–11" | 12–14" |
Height (female) | 10–11" | 12–14" |
Weight (male) | 15–20 lbs | 11–20 lbs |
Weight (female) | 15–20 lbs | 11–20 lbs |
Lifespan Average expected lifespan. | 11–15 years | 12–15 years |
Energy level Daily activity needs. | High (4/5) | High (4/5) |
Trainability How quickly the breed learns commands. | High (4/5) | High (4/5) |
Intelligence Problem-solving ability. | High (4/5) | High (4/5) |
Exercise needs Daily physical activity required. | Moderate (3/5) | Moderate (3/5) |
Shedding Lower = less hair around your home. | Low (2/5) | Very Low (1/5) |
Grooming effort Brushing, bathing, professional grooming. | Moderate (3/5) | High (4/5) |
Drooling Lower = drier face and furniture. | Very Low (1/5) | Very Low (1/5) |
Barking How vocal the breed is. | Moderate (3/5) | High (4/5) |
Good with kids | High (4/5) | High (4/5) |
Good with other dogs | Moderate (3/5) | Moderate (3/5) |
Good with strangers | Moderate (3/5) | Moderate (3/5) |
Protectiveness Watchdog tendencies. | Moderate (3/5) | High (4/5) |
Adaptability Apartment / new environment tolerance. | High (4/5) | Very High (5/5) |
Coat length | wirehaired | wirehaired |
Hypoallergenic Lower-shedding, less dander. | Yes | Yes |

About the Australian Terrier
The Australian Terrier is a spirited, alert, courageous Australian outback ratter — the first breed developed Down Under. Originally from Australia, this small terrier breed typically weighs 15–20 lbs and lives 11–15 years. Breeders describe them as spirited, alert, courageous.
About the Miniature Schnauzer
The Miniature Schnauzer is a friendly, smart, obedient ratter — the eyebrowed, bearded German farm dog scaled down for family life. Originally from Germany, this small terrier breed typically weighs 11–20 lbs and lives 12–15 years. Breeders describe them as friendly, smart, obedient.

Australian Terrier health
Common health concerns reported in this breed:
- • Patellar luxation
- • Diabetes
- • Allergies
Miniature Schnauzer health
Common health concerns reported in this breed:
- • Pancreatitis
- • Diabetes
- • Bladder stones
- • Cataracts
